How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Natomas Creek?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Natomas Creek Studio Apartments | $2,070 | $1,773 | $2,175 |
Natomas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,179 | $1,042 | $2,608 |
Natomas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,766 | $1,245 | $3,327 |
Natomas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,180 | $2,566 | $3,997 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Natomas Creek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Natomas Creek?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Natomas Creek with Washer/Dryer is at Northlake Senior Apartments (55+) listed at $1,042.
How much is the average rent for Natomas Creek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Natomas Creek with Washer/Dryer is $2,156.
What is the largest Natomas Creek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Natomas Creek is a 1,730 square feet unit starting from $2,180 at Homecoming at Creekside.
What is the average size for Natomas Creek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Natomas Creek is currently at 688 sq ft.
